One-third of Tennesseans planning spring break trip

Miami Beach

Nearly one-third of Tennesseans plan on taking a spring break trip between March and early April, according to information collected by AAA. The organization said more families are planning trips this year than last year despite inflation. The average gas prices are down nearly a dollar from this time last year, which may be contributing to why many families are deciding to take spring vacations. Most Tennesseans are considering trips to beaches in Florida or Alabama as well as cruises.
